What Exactly Is a Generator?

Generator is a device that converts mechanical energy into usable electrical power for off-grid or backup use. Generators can run on diesel, natural gas, gasoline, or other fuel sources, catering to different power needs across agriculture, industry, and residential settings. Key Steps to Choose the Right Generator

Most buyers make mistakes when sizing their generator, so follow these proven steps to get the right model for your needs:

  1. Calculate your total required wattage by adding up the power of all devices you need to run, then add 20% extra headroom to avoid overloading.
  2. Match the generator type to your use case: pick portable for temporary use, standby for permanent home backup, and heavy-duty industrial for large farm operations.
  3. Compare long-term operating costs based on fuel efficiency, especially if you will use the generator regularly.
  4. Verify the manufacturer's warranty and after-sales support before making your purchase.

Basic Generator Maintenance for Longevity

Proper maintenance can extend your generator's lifespan by 3 to 10 years, so it is critical to follow a regular care schedule. Even the highest-quality generators will fail early without basic upkeep.

Q: How often should I service my generator?

A: For generators used more than 10 hours per week, schedule a full service every 100 hours of operation, or at least once every 6 months. For standby generators, run the unit for 10 minutes once a month to keep parts lubricated, and service annually. From our experience, skipping monthly testing increases failure risk by 40% when you need power most.

Q: Is it safe to leave fuel in my generator long-term?

A: Gasoline degrades in 3 to 6 months, so do not leave gasoline in a generator for more than 30 days without a fuel stabilizer. Diesel can last up to 12 months when stored properly in a sealed tank, which is another key benefit of diesel generators for long-term use.

Q: How long can a generator run continuously?

A: Properly maintained industrial diesel generators can run continuously for 24 to 72 hours without stopping, depending on fuel tank size. Portable generators typically need refueling every 8 to 12 hours, and require a 10-minute cool down before refueling.

Q: Is it safe to use a generator indoors?

A: No, all fuel-powered generators produce toxic carbon monoxide that can be fatal in enclosed spaces. Always operate generators in well-ventilated outdoor areas at least 20 feet away from buildings, with exhaust directed away from occupied spaces.

Q: What is the average lifespan of a generator?

A: With regular maintenance, a high-quality industrial diesel generator can last 15 to 30 years. Portable inverter generators typically last 10 to 15 years with proper care. Low-quality models may fail within 3 to 5 years even with regular maintenance.
